Как добавить каталог и подкаталоги в установочном пакете - PullRequest
0 голосов
/ 09 марта 2020

У меня есть много файлов и папок, которые нужно добавить в мой установочный пакет. Я попробовал команду

Файл / нефатальный / a / r "C: \ Users \ test \ hdp *"

и

File / nonfatal / a / r "C: \ Users \ test \ hdp \"

, но он не создал выходной файл (.exe). Я также попытался с zip-файлом (имеется в виду созданный zip-файл из папки hdp) и добавил его в пакет, но та же проблема, с которой я сталкиваюсь и с zip-файлом. Размер папки hdp составляет всего 250 МБ.

В документации также не упоминается опция добавления папки. Может кто-нибудь подсказать, как добавить эти папки и подпапки в пакет?

1 Ответ

1 голос
/ 09 марта 2020

Вы должны начать с Example1.nsi и понять все его инструкции, прежде чем пытаться написать настоящий установщик.

OutFile "myinstaller.exe" ; Name of generated installer .exe
InstallDir "$Desktop\MyApp" ; Change this

Page Directory
Page InstFiles

Section
SetOutPath $InstDir
File /r "c:\users\test\myfilestoinstall\*.*" ; Change this
SectionEnd
...